問題タブ [masked-array]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
python-2.7 - numpy マスクを結合するために logical_and を使用する
同様の質問が寄せられているのを見てきましたが、マスクの組み合わせにまだ苦労しています。
これは私のコードです:
data
結合したマスクを配置したい配列です。
a.mask
結合されたマスクをプロットすると、本来よりもはるかに高い値が返されるため、無視されたようです。つまり、200 を超えるものは以前はマスクされていましたが、ここでは 300 まで返されます。
a.mask
b.mask
すでに定義およびチェックされているので、問題は結合だと思います。どちらも、私が求めている真/偽の値ではなく整数を返します。
ありがとうございました
python - マスクされた配列を、マスクされた値を None として持つ単純な配列として返します
a
別の配列によって満たされた条件で配列をマスクする必要がありb
ます。
たとえば、 の値は、同じ位置の値が0 に等しいa
場合にのみ保持する必要があります。それ以外の場合は、 として返します。例えば:b
None
によってマスクされています
戻る
私が試してみました
しかし、これは次を返します:
しかし、 の例のようなものを返すだけのものは見つかりませんc
。
numpy
これは非常に大きな配列の場合になるため、速度のために、forループまたはifステートメントの有無にかかわらず、完全に何かを行う必要があります。私は何が欠けていますか?